Maral Yeganeh Doost is a leading researcher in neurorehabilitation, with a primary focus on motor recovery after stroke. Her work centers on understanding how robotic assistance can enhance bimanual motor skill learning, particularly for chronic hemiparetic patients. In her landmark 2021 randomized controlled trial, which has garnered 25 citations, she investigated whether active-assisted robotic training could improve bimanual coordination more effectively than conventional methods. This study addressed a critical gap in stroke rehabilitation, demonstrating that robotic devices can be optimized to facilitate neural plasticity and functional recovery. Beyond this, her research explores the intersection of motor control, robotics, and neuroplasticity, aiming to translate engineering innovations into clinical practice.
